India's inflation drops further to 8.9 pc

IANS

New Delhi: India's annual rate of inflation fell further to 8.9 per cent for the week ended November 8, from 8.98 per cent for the week before, fresh data showed on Thursday.

The fall in inflation rate was the result of a 0.2 per cent drop in the official wholesale price index (WPI) during the week. The index for fuels fell by 0.9 per cent, while that for manufactured goods declined 0.2 per cent.

The statistics released by the commerce and industry ministry also pointed out that the index for primary articles, which has a weight of 22.02 per cent in the general index, rose by 0.4 per cent during the week under review.

The annual rate of inflation stood at 3.2 per cent during the corresponding week last year.
